Henry Roberts Pease (February 19, 1835 – January 2, 1907) was an American lawyer, educator, and politician who served as a United States senator for Mississippi from 1874 to 1875.
He also served as the state's first superintendent of education and was a member of the South Dakota Senate for one term.
